Redeem the Stream

Alpha TestingAlpha’s Alberto Flores and his wife gave their Saturday morning to help clean up the Trinity River at the Redeem the Stream: Dallas River Cleanup, put on by the North Texas American Water Works Association (AWWA) and the Water Environment Association of Texas (WEAT). Volunteers paddled and hiked their way around the Green Belt of the Elm Fork – a floodplain area of the Trinity that is a collection point for trash. In just one morning, volunteers freed the Green Belt from 5,580 pounds of trash and debris! Now that’s redeeming.Alpha Testing
